S-Box Slows Down Toca & Auto Modellista
S-Box Slows Down Toca & Auto Modellista –
10-11-2002,04:12 PM
Hi guys,
I have a s-box and V4 Pal PS2. Some of my racing games slow down and have jerky graphics when playing. I can fix this problem when i turn off s-box whilst playing or use the knife trick to boot up instead. My other backups like gt3 a spec and shox play perfectly. Anyone got this problem, is it the chip, laser ?
I have feedback from other s-box users and they also have similar problems like fmv skipping.
If i was to add a no solder mod with it could that solve the problems.
Cheers.

10-11-2002,06:10 PM
i doubt it. i believe the reason for this is due to the "noisy" scex signa; that is constantly outputted by the sbox. this is why the problems dont happen when you turn it off. so just it off after booting..

10-14-2002,05:55 PM
OK Guys got it working.
I installed a capacitor (.47microfard 63v capacitor).
I Fitted it in and now it's superb. No more jumpy graphics or slow down. The funny thing is that now when i boot up with the backup just after the cd spins to load for the first time i switch the s-box off and then it loads. If i switch it on now it makes a clicking noise. So no need to leave it switched on anymore!!! Before it was the other way round, i had to leave it switched on for it to work but that would cause the problem.
Thanks Guys for all your help.
